In addition to treating mesothelioma, a mesothelioma lawyer should be familiar with the state's laws and regulations on asbestos claims. The statute of limitations is a time limit which victims and their families must meet. The time frame for filing a claim is different for each state, but it can be as small as one year. If a claim isn't filed on time, victims may lose their right to receive compensation. An attorney for mesothelioma can explain the limitations period and how it may apply to a specific case. They can also assist the victims and their families in determining the best place to file a lawsuit.

Fees

Most mesothelioma attorneys work on a contingent fee. This means that clients do not pay anything upfront and only pay if they win. You should inquire with the lawyer about any additional expenses that could be related with your case. Some firms charge for photocopies and court filing fees while others include them in the contingency payments. In addition, many mesothelioma lawyers can also charge attorney fees, which could vary significantly.

Cases were won

Lanier Law Firm is dedicated to helping victims of mesothelioma across the United the United States. Their attorneys have won millions in settlements and jury verdicts for their clients. They have won multi-million dollar lawsuits against asbestos producers including Johnson & Johnson. The company was hit with an award of $30 million for mesothelioma back in 2016.
